Born: 5 March 1813 in La Prairie, Lower Canada
Spouse(s)/Partner(s) and Child(ren):
Felicite married Frederic-Moise TREMBLAY 18 January 1831 in Napierville, Lower Canada . Frederic-Moise TREMBLAY was born 6 November 1802 in La Prairie, Québec, Canada (St-Philippe) (St-Jean-François-Régis) (La Nativité). Frederic-Moise was the child of Henri-Eloi TREMBLAY and Marie-Reine-Felicite RAYMOND.
Felicite DESLIPPE died 6 February 1871 in Amhertsburg, Essex, Ontario, Canada.

From its inception in the early 1600s until 1760, it was called Canada, New France.
1760 to 1763, it was simply Canada
1763 to 1791 - Province of Québec
1791 to 1867 - Lower Canada
1867 to present - Québec, Canada.
